How Do You Print a Double Sided Brochure on Canva?

Last updated on September 27, 2022 @ 7:03 pm

When it comes to printing a double sided brochure, there are a few things you need to take into account. First, you need to make sure that your design is laid out correctly for printing. This means that your text and images should be positioned in such a way that they will print correctly on both sides of the page. Secondly, you need to make sure that you have the correct paper stock for your project.

Double sided brochures require a heavier weight paper so that the ink does not bleed through to the other side. Finally, you need to make sure that your printer is capable of printing double sided brochures. Some printers do not have this capability, so you will need to check with yours before proceeding.

Assuming that you have all of the necessary materials and equipment, printing a double sided brochure is relatively simple. Most printers these days have duplex (double sided) printing capabilities, so all you need to do is select that option in your print settings before sending your document to print.

If your printer does not have duplex printing capabilities, you can still print double sided brochures by printing the odd numbered pages first, flipping the stack of paper over, and then printing the even numbered pages.
